Sezzle is a financial technology company that offers a "buy now, pay later" service, allowing consumers to purchase products and pay for them in four interest-free installments over six weeks. The Sezzle app provides users with a flexible financing alternative to traditional credit cards, enabling instant approval decisions without impacting credit scores. Sezzle partners with various top brands, including Amazon, Walmart, and Target, to offer in-app and in-store payment options. The company's mission is to empower consumers financially by providing more financial freedom and control. It is available as a mobile app, with millions of downloads and high user ratings, and works towards accessibility and inclusion on its platform.

• Own the banking platform roadmap supporting accounts, deposits, cards, and lending on a single ledger and account model • Evaluate core banking platforms and processors, conduct vendor diligence, model cost and time-to-market, and support build-versus-buy decisions • Shape account hierarchies, sub-ledgers, chart-of-accounts mapping, posting rules, holds, interest and fee accrual, and general ledger integration • Own product requirements for transfers, ACH, card issuing and network settlement, real-time rails, returns and reversals, exception handling, cutoff windows, and settlement reconciliation • Ensure reporting, traceability, controls, reconciliation breaks, balance attestation, and complete transaction history for Finance, audit, and regulators • Partner with Compliance and Legal to translate regulatory requirements into platform capabilities • Own data mapping, parallel-run strategy, validation criteria, rollback plans, and phased cutover for migrations • Write detailed technical specifications, API contracts, event schemas, data models, user stories, and release plans • Write SQL, define platform KPIs, and monitor posting latency, reconciliation break rate, settlement accuracy, and failure rates • Anticipate technical risks, edge cases, race conditions, and dependencies • Deliver against evolving regulatory and business timelines with incomplete information
• Bachelor’s or advanced deg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or another technical discipline (required) • 5–10 years of product experience, including meaningful financial infrastructure experience • Real ownership in ledgers, general ledger or balance and transaction systems; payments processing or money movement; card issuing; deposit, wallet or account platforms; lending platforms; or processor, BaaS provider or core banking vendor product work • Comfort with double-entry accounting concepts, including debits and credits, sub-ledgers, accruals, and reconciliation, or genuine willingness to learn them quickly • Deep technical understanding of APIs, event-driven architecture, idempotency, distributed-system failure modes, batch versus real-time processing, and data flows • Strong SQL skills and ability to query and interpret data independently • Experience working directly with Compliance, Legal, Finance, or Treasury stakeholders • Ability to work in ambiguity and make sound, documented decisions with incomplete information • Strong written and verbal communication • Hands-on familiarity with AI tools, data models, or generative AI applications
